Hydration Safety campaign reminds field staff to drink up

Throughout February Winslow has actively promoted its Hydration Safety campaign with drink bottles distributed to field employees across the Group, who also have been involved in toolboxes about tips to avoid dehydration.

Working outdoors in summer, and often in heat, can be hazardous and can cause harm if not managed effectively.

One of the common effects of working in heat is the risk of dehydration. Men and women need between two and 2.5 litres of fluids daily to maintain hydration.

Research also suggests a strong connection between hydration and mental health, with inadequate water intake (dehydration) potentially leading to negative impacts on mood, cognitive function, and increased anxiety, while proper hydration can support emotional stability and better mental wellbeing. 

Our new Am I drinking enough water? posters also provide some easy markers to keep people on track with adequate hydration with a link to some self-directed learning if people want to find out more.
